Vue.js 的强大自功能详解方便使用编译模板 将模板转换成可渲染的内容
Vue.js 的强大自定义功能详解
一、组件
组件是 Vue.js 的灵魂,就像积木一样,让开发者能轻松构建应用。
定义组件: 就像搭积木一样,你可以定义各种组件,让它们可重用。
局部注册: 就像在玩具箱里找到你想要的积木,组件也可以局部注册,方便使用。
二、指令
指令就是告诉 Vue 怎么样去操作 DOM。
全局指令: 全局指令就像家里的电灯开关,无处不在。
局部指令: 局部指令就像你的个人玩具,只在特定的地方使用。
三、插件
插件就像给你的手机装应用,让 Vue 更强大。
创建插件: 你可以创建自己的插件,就像开发手机应用一样。
使用插件: 安装插件后,Vue 就有了新的功能。
四、过滤器
过滤器就是给数据穿件衣服,让它看起来更漂亮。
全局过滤器: 全局的过滤器就像每个人都有的标准服装。
局部过滤器: 局部过滤器就像你的私人定制。
五、混入(Mixins)
混入就像将两个积木拼在一起,让它们有相同的功能。
定义混入: 就像制作积木套装,混入将功能封装起来。
使用混入: 将混入应用到组件中,就像给积木添加功能。
六、钩子函数
钩子函数就像在积木搭建过程中的提示,告诉你什么时候该做什么。
创建阶段: 在组件创建时的提示。
挂载阶段: 在组件挂载到页面时的提示。
七、全局配置
全局配置就像给积木盒规定摆放规则。
配置生产提示: 生产环境下的提示。
配置错误处理: 错误处理的方式。
八、渲染函数
渲染函数就像自己动手搭建积木。
简单渲染函数: 基础的搭建方式。
动态渲染函数: 动态搭建,更灵活。
九、模板编译
模板编译就像把积木图变成真实的积木。
编译模板: 将模板转换成可渲染的内容。
使用编译结果: 使用编译后的结果进行渲染。
十、事件处理
事件处理就像积木搭建完成后的互动。
事件监听: 监听用户的操作。
事件修饰符: 对事件进行特殊处理。
Vue.js 提供了丰富的自定义选项,让开发者能根据需求灵活调整应用的行为和功能。这些自定义选项不仅提高了代码的可维护性和重用性,还增强了应用的性能和用户体验。
FAQs
问题 | 答案 |
---|---|
Vue.js能够自定义哪些内容? | Vue.js 允许开发者自定义指令、过滤器、组件、事件和插件等,以满足不同的需求。 |